SCCM Newly Installed DP is Not Visible in Console RBAC Gotcha. Recently, I’ve seen another RBA gotcha. The CM 12 administrator has been assigned to the “Infrastructure Administrator” security role along with the correct security scope for his location.

He has all the necessary rights to install Remote Site Systems and Site Servers on his primary server. He has also successfully created a remote distribution point attached to the primary site.

However, he cannot view that remote distribution point (DP) in the SCCM 2012 Console after a successful DP installation. Now what?

Why can he not view the remote distribution point he installed? OK, it’s because of the Security Scope. After the installation, CM 2012 will automatically assign Site Systems security scope as “Default”.

Do you know where to set the “Security Scopes” for Distribution Points? It’s NOT under Administration –> Site Configuration –> Server and Site System Roles! However, it’s there under Administration –> Distribution Points.

So, how do you change the security scope? Request the team that handles the CAS server or the site’s Full Administrator to change the Security Scope. Remove the default security scope for the DP and add the required security Scope for that country. 

Once this is done, the DP will be visible to the CM 12 admin with “Infrastructure Administrator” access.
